1956 Supreme(AP) 161

Makutam Basavalingam – Appellant
Versus
Makutam Swarajyalakshmi – Respondent


CHANDRA REDDY, J.

( 1 ) THIS application was filed under Article 226 of the constitution to issue an order, direction or writ particularly one in the nature of habeas corpus to the 2nd and 3rd respondents herein directing him to produce the baby, son of the petitioner, before this Court immediately and then restore it to his custody.
